     We took a step inside the camp. There were hundreds of kids and teens that varied in size and shape and even color. But each had the same star birth mark on their arm.
     "You, Claudia, have access to every level in the camp." Dr. Bial was looking around as if his mind could take pictures of everything that he was seeing, which anything could be possible at this point.
     "But there's only one level in this camp. I don't see an elevator or stairs or anything." Julia tripped over a wire on the ground. It ran from a wall, into one of the kid's head. Julia looked like she was going to throw up.
     "Look again," Dr. Bial pointed up into the air, where a transparent staircase formed in front of our eyes.
     I took the first step onto the staircase. Dr. Bial and Julia followed behind me. We walked in silence until we reached the top of the steps.
     "Dr. Bial, there's nothing here," I looked around the beautiful night sky in curiosity as in why there is a staircase that lead to no where.
     "Just walk," Dr. Bial was standing one step below me.
